Understanding Mesotherapy
Mesotherapy is a minimally invasive procedure that involves the micro-injection of therapeutic substances into the skin’s mesodermal layer. This technique is popular among aesthetic practitioners due to its ability to address a wide range of skin issues, including ageing, pigmentation, and dehydration. The success of mesotherapy largely depends on the quality of the products used. Therefore, it is important to select products that are specifically designed for this purpose and have been tested for safety and effectiveness.
Key Ingredients to Look For
When choosing mesotherapy products, practitioners should look for ingredients that are known for their rejuvenating and revitalising properties. Hyaluronic acid is a popular choice due to its ability to hydrate and plump the skin. Vitamins such as A, C, and E are also beneficial for their antioxidant properties, helping to protect the skin from environmental damage. Additionally, amino acids and peptides can support collagen production and improve skin elasticity. It is advisable to select products that combine these ingredients to maximise the benefits of mesotherapy treatments.
